  4. Was doing a mayhem mission on a team, had a stalker. Every pull, the PPD Equalizer died before we started fighting. It was pretty much effortless. No other AT could have done that, so far as I know.

    So I think stalkers have substantial value to a team, it just has to be a team that isn't going to be facerolling the content, and can understand the advantage of letting the stalker, well, stalk.

  10. A few thoughts:

    1. I would never, ever, put off a demon-summoning power. Ever. Not even for Stamina.
    2. I'm currently loving teleport as a pool. TP Foe is very helpful for getting lone minions out of a mob -- and that can be a great way to heal the little pets. (TG's dependence on a target can impose some strange strategies.) It's also a good way to split larger groups up.
    3. I would never put off Fearsome Stare if I could possibly take it; I'm pretty fond of it.

    Here's my work-in-progress build, such as it is. I'm pretty torn on several parts; in particular, I'm not yet endurance-starved, but I'm guessing I will be soon enough. (I'm level 12.) In practice, I'm pretty sure Stamina isn't really essential until I get more toggles -- I can keep up DN and spam attacks without much hassle.

  13. My big concern: Chain-ambushes.

    On one of the missions I did recently, on my stalker, I got into the building, cleared maybe one or two mobs, and then...

    Got ambushed by a lt and two minions.
    Got ambushed by three minions.
    Got ambushed by three minions.
    Got ambushed by three minions.
    Got ambushed by three minions.
    Got ambushed by three minions.
    Got ambushed by three minions.
    Got ambushed by three minions.
    Got ambushed by three minions.

    ... Nine ambushes total. Chaining. About 10 seconds between killing the last mob of one group and the next group spawning.

    And every one of these groups had the Magical Ability To See You that utterly nerfs stalkers, because the ENTIRE POINT OF THE ARCHETYPE is not being seen. So of course, the most FUN thing to do would be to have NINE AMBUSHES IN A ROW, without long enough between them for Rest to start healing you, all of which can magically attack you even though you're Hidden, even if you move into another room after they spawn.

    ... No, wait. Not fun. Stupid.

    Sure, I beat it. I even levelled from the extra XP. Heck, this is FARMABLE, because all I have to do is reset the mission and the XP come to me. When my MM gets to that level, you better believe I'm gonna reset that mission a couple of times to get extra free XP off it.

    But it's stupid. It's not fun, at least on a stalker. It violates the basic premise of the archetype, and missions should not invalidate an archetype. (And yes, let's also mention the escorts who can't follow a hidden stalker. That, too, is not fun. Let's just assume I'm talking to them so they can follow me or something.)

    A couple of ambushes now and then? Fun. Chain ambushes with no downtime? Not so much fun.

    I've found that /traps can be AMAZING in teams -- if the team is able to get their head around the idea that the weak little mastermind with "low" hit points is running in and toe-bombing.

    Seeker drones, poison gas trap... As someone commented, "seeker drones turn alphas into lolphas".

  25. I love triage beacon, but the key is, you have to know which fights you want it on, and drop it first. It also becomes MUCH more useful in the 20s, when you can massively boost its heals. Mine's 5-slotted with a healing set and is amazing.
